Summary
Allergy involves immune hypersensitivity to allergens, with rising incidence linked to genetics, environment, and lifestyle factors like diet and pollution. Research aims to develop new therapies for managing and preventing allergic sensitization.

Background:
- Allergy is a hypersensitivity reaction mediated by immunoglobulin E (IgE) and mast cells.
- Allergic diseases have increasing incidence and prevalence, linked to genetic and environmental factors.
- Western lifestyle factors, including indoor environments, diet, pollution, and stress, exacerbate allergy risks and asthma development.

Main Results:
- Allergic reactions are triggered by allergen-specific IgE cross-linking on mast cells, releasing inflammatory mediators.
- A significant increase in allergic disease incidence and prevalence is observed.
- Western lifestyle factors are associated with increased risk of allergic diseases and asthma.
Conclusions:
- Understanding allergic mechanisms is crucial for developing new therapies.
- Interventions targeting environmental and lifestyle factors may help manage and prevent allergic sensitization.
